Text
(a)A new certificate of registration to replace any revoked, lost, destroyed, or mutilated certificate may be issued, subject to the rules of the Arkansas Forestry Commission, and for a charge fixed by the commission.
(b)The commission may also reissue a certificate of registration to any person whose certificate has been revoked if:
(1)A majority of the commission members present vote in favor of reissuance; and (2) The person presents satisfactory assurances that the grounds which caused the certificate to be revoked will not occur again and that the person is otherwise qualified to be registered hereunder.
